
France and Poland on Friday will sign a new strategic cooperation treaty, with Polish leader Donald Tusk insisting that a mutual security pledge will be at the heart of the agreement. "For me, absolutely the most important issue was the mutual security guarantees" in the accord, Tusk told reporters as he prepared to travel to France.
